J'ai recherché rapidement et je n'ai pas trouvé de réponse à mon problème que voici :
Je voudrais pouvoir changer la date d'ajout de photos, en général pour toute une catégorie.
En effet, lorsque je crée une nouvelle catégorie, je la verrouille le temps que j'ajoute mes photos
Ceci me prend souvent beaucoup de temps ce qui fait que quand je donne l'accès à la
catégorie :
- les dates d'ajouts peuvent s'étaler sur une longue période, ce qui n'est pas cohérent
lorsqu'il s'agit d'un lot de photos prises lors d'une même unité de temps.
- les photos peuvent ne plus apparaître dans les images récentes.
Quelle est la solution :
supprimer le répertoire, synchroniser, remettre le répertoire, synchroniser ?
modifier les champs dans la base MySQL (PhpMyAdmin) ? Si oui, quels champs sont
à modifier ?
Cordialement
Hors ligne
Bon, pas de réponse :-( Je précise donc :
frantz a écrit:
supprimer le répertoire, synchroniser, remettre le répertoire, synchroniser ?
Si je fais ça alors que j'ai ajouté également des images dans d'autres catégories,
est-ce que les photos risquent de changer d'identifiant ?
Dernière modification par frantz (2008-04-21 11:15:51)
Hors ligne
Yes... dans 99% des cas.
8-(
Le plus simple est de te donner la requête SQL qui ira bien.
8-)
Hors ligne
Hors ligne
UPDATE `phpwebgallery_images` SET date_available = now( )
WHERE id IN (SELECT image_id
FROM `phpwebgallery_image_category`
WHERE category_id = 20 )
Remplace le 20 par l'id de la catégorie que tu vas publier (et dévérouiller).
L'url de modification de la catégorie indique l'id...
page=cat_modify&cat_id=xx
Toutes les images de la catégorie seront alors à nouveau récentes.
8-)
PS: La requête ne fonctionne que pour des versions récentes de MySQL.
Hors ligne
Extra ! Merci beaucoup :-) Je vais essayer ça.
VDigital a écrit:
PS: La requête ne fonctionne que pour des versions récentes de MySQL.
Je suis chez free qui a la version 5.0.45 de MySQL
Hors ligne
Cela doit fonctionner sauf erreur de ta part.
8-)
Hors ligne
ça marche impeccable :-) Encore merci.
Hors ligne